Computation of the largest Lyapunov exponent using recursive estimation with variable factor
Chaotic systems have been investigated in the most diverse areas. One of the
first steps in chaotic system research is the detection of chaos. The largest
Lyapunov exponent (LLE) is one of the most widely used techniques for this
purpose. Recently, techniques for calculating LLE have been developed taking
into account the error due to the finite precision of computers. Recursive
methods were employed to improve such algorithms. However, this method
uniformly weighed the data used to calculate the LLE. This paper investigates
the different weighing of the data based on the hypothesis that the initial
data have a higher precision than the last data processed by the algorithm,
since the process is subject to error accumulation. In five tested systems, the
proposed method obtained more accurate results in three. However, there was an
increase in the variance of the result obtained for two of the evaluated
